I've hit both and currently testing the Anser for review.  Both are really good.  The 913 has more options in terms of adjustability.  The Anser has a similar shape to the G20/913 D2 with the black matte finish and produced lower spin than both those drivers.  In terms of spin, the Anser is between the G20 and i20.  D3 has a more compact head, very similar to the 910 D3, sounds great and I would say has similar spin characteristics to the Anser.

You can't really go wrong with either, just depends on the look you prefer at address.
